HFS: Haldwani Forest Plantation

HFS site photos

General site details

Site nameHaldwani Forest Plantation
AsiaFlux site codeHFS
LocationHaldwani, Uttarakhand
Position29° 8'57.55"N , 79°25'15.97"E
Elevation280 m
Slope<2 degree
Terrain typeFlat
Area4547.97 ha
Fetch1000 m
ClimateSubtropical Humid
Mean annual air temperature40°C in July and 5°C in December
Mean annual precipitation1250 mm
Vegetation typeMixed Forest Plantation
Dominant Species (Overstory)Holoptelea integrifolia, Dalbergia sisso, Acacia catechu
Dominant Species (Understory)Lantan camera, Murraya koennigii and Cleodendron viscosum
Canopy height10 m
AgeYoung Plantation (9 years in 2013)
LAI2.9
Soil typeNon-Calcareous and deep

Observation

Eddy Covariance method (CO2)

SystemOpen-path system
Wind speed3-D Sonic Anemometer (WindMaster, Gill)
Air temperature3-D Sonic Anemometer (WindMaster, Gill)
Water vaporOpen-path CO2/H2O analyzer (LI-7500, LI-COR)
CO2Open-path CO2/H2O analyzer (LI-7500, LI-COR)
Measurement height19 m
Sampling frequency10 Hz
Averaging time30 min
Data loggerCR5000 (Campbell,USA)
Data storageFC
Original dataRaw data

Meteorology

Observation items Levels/Depth Instrument
Global solar radiation(incoming) 15 m Net radiometer (CNR-1, Campbell)
Global solar radiation (outgoing) 15 m Net radiometer (CNR-1, Campbell)
Long-wave radiation(outgoing) 15 m Net radiometer (CNR-1, Campbell)
Long-wave radiation(outgoing) 15 m Net radiometer (CNR-1, Campbell)
Net radiation 15 m Net radiometer (CNR-1, Campbell)
PPFD (incoming) 15 m Quantum senser (LI-190S, LI-COR)
PPFD (outgoing) -
Direct / diffuse radiation -
Direct / diffuse PPFD -
Air temperature 5, 10, 15 m Temperature and Relative Humidity Probe (Vaisala HMP50, Finland)
Humidity 5, 10, 15 m Temperature and Relative Humidity Probe (Vaisala HMP50, Finland)
Soil temperature -
Soil heat flux -
Soil water content -
Wind speed 5, 10, 15 m RM Young 5103 ( Secondwind,USA)
Wind direction 5, 10, 15 m RM Young 5103 ( Secondwind,USA)
Barometric pressure 15 m Vaisala PTB110 Barometer
Precipitation 15 m Tipping Bucket ( Texas TE525)
CO2 concentration -
H2O concentration -

Other

Soil respiration Automated soil CO2 Flux (LI-8100, LI-COR,USA)
Photosynthesis -
Ecological investigation LAI, Biomass, Litter production & decomposition, Litter C:N etc.
